Additional information

The author made substantial contributions to formulating the scientific aims of this experiment and to its conception and design, implementing and extending his technique of covariance mapping to fully exploit the capabilities of the free-electron laser (FEL) in Hamburg. He wrote a large part of the data acquisition software, took part in the experimental run and influenced the choice of experimental conditions. He also analysed the data, drafted the paper and guided the theoretical simulations performed by the first author.
